  • cleave
    cleave (2), intransitive verb, cleavedor (Archaic)clave,cleaved,cleaving.
    to hold fast; cling.
    Ex. to cleave to an idea. He was so frightened that his tongue cleaved to the roof of his mouth. For I cleaved to a cause that I felt to be pure and

  • cleave
    v.i. 1. to split with a smooth, plane fracture, or in layers; fall asunder.
    2. to cut one's way; penetrate; pass.

  • cleave
    v.t. 1a. to cut, divide, or split open; hew asunder.
    Ex. A blow of the whale's tail cleft our boat in two.
    b. to pass through; pierce; penetrate.
    Ex. The airplane swept across the sky, cleaving the clouds.
    2. to make by cutting.
